2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ic vs. 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ic

To start off, both 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ic and 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ic were released in the same year (2007).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 2,996 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ic (255 HP @ 6600 RPM) has 27 more horse power than 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ic. (228 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ic should accelerate faster than 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ic weights approximately 170 kg more than 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ic.

Because 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ic (500 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 200 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ic. (300 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ic.

Compare all specifications:

2007 BMW 330 i Touring Automatic 2007 BMW 330 xd Touring Automatic
Make BMW BMW
Model 330 330
Year Released 2007 2007
Body Type Station Wagon Station Wagon
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2996 cc 2993 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 255 HP 228 HP
Engine RPM 6600 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 300 Nm 500 Nm
Torque RPM 2500 RPM 1750 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 10.7:1 17.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Diesel
Top Speed 250 km/hour 233 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 6.4 seconds 6.7 seconds
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1605 kg 1775 kg
Vehicle Length 4480 mm 4480 mm
Vehicle Width 1820 mm 1820 mm
Vehicle Height 1420 mm 1420 mm
Wheelbase Size 2770 mm 2770 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 8.9 L/100km 7.4 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 63 L 61 L
